Trojans Host Jones County

J.T. Hall Coliseum heats up tonight as the Jones County Community College Bobcats for am MACCC matchup with the MDCC Trojans. Tip-off is at 6:00 p.m. Trojan Head Coach Derrick Fears is looking for more conference wins to build his young team's confidence.

The Jones County team "is a pretty good team and give us matchup problems. Our big guys don't move their feet very well and other teams are figuring that out. Jones is a guard-oriented group. Even their bigs are guards. They are good ball handlers and their skill level is high. Hopefully, we can offset that by being at home and shoot the ball well." 

Jones County is 11-6 overall, 4-3 MACCC. The Trojans, 5-14 overall, 2-6 MACCC will have a one-week break from the hardwood after Jones. The Trojans lost on the road to Holmes Community College (11-6 overall and 3-4 MACCC) this past Monday, 79-68. Trojan Head Coach Derrick Fears' team faced several hurdles in the loss.

 "It's tough on the freshman to function on the road and the officiating was the worst we've had. I had three players in foul trouble within the first six minutes of the ballgame," Coach Fears. "Then we were dependent on guys we weren't relying on to play and carry their weight and pull us through. It's hard to come back from that. Most of the guys fouled out and Holmes is a very physical team. Foul trouble really hurt us last night."

Nicholas Council came off the bench to lead the Trojans with 16 points. Jequann Roberson had 14 points and four rebounds and Jherrone Jones had 14 points and four assists. Jeremiah Foster added 10 points and 10 rebounds. The team shot 40 percent from the field on 21-of-53 shooting. They hit 6-of-19 three-pointers for 32 percent and improved their free-throw shooting to 83 percent on 20-of-24 shots.

With the week off from competition, Coach Fears is looking to turn the temperature up in the gym and iron out both offensive and defensive problems and put in more conditioning work.

"It's a needed gap and it will give us more time to prep to play Northeast (13-9 overall and 4-4 MACCC,) one of the better ballclubs," he said.

With Freshman Latrell Vance out due to knee problems, the team has suffered without him on the floor.

"We won two of three with him back and the loss was a two-point ballgame. Without him, we struggle to score and rebound," he said. "When he went out again, we've down double digits. He is a key component."
